On Wed, Jun 28, 2023 at 7:46 PM Eric Cook <llua@gmx.com> wrote:
>
> On 6/28/23 16:10, Jon Oster wrote:
> > In 5.8.1, $RANDOM seems not to update its state when the command $RANDOM
> > was used in is piped somewhere. For example:
> >
> > Is this considered a bug? Or is it intended behaviour?
> >
> > [1] https://sourceforge.net/p/zsh/code/ci/faf0035e532cde45528806e7a05ad28a0ab7c0fb/
>
> The LHS of the pipe should be a subshell, so the behavior is intentional.

This was, however, an unanticipated side-effect of the referenced
commit.  It changed behavior (that, before, did not conform to the
documentation) without that fact being called out in any of our files
that serve as release notes.

It opens the question of whether anything else that previously was
"pre-fork" might have changed behavior at that point.
